How Do I Purchase and Replace Plastic Sofa Legs?

Sometimes sofa legs need to be replaced. Your sofa may have a broken leg, you may want your sofa further off the floor or just want to replace scratched or dated legs. Replacing legs can revitalize your sofa. An inexpensive way to replace your sofa legs is with plastic legs. The high-density polyethylene plastic is high quality, easy to install and about half the price of wooden legs. The style is classic and compatible with the more expensive legs.

Instructions

    • 1

      Turn the sofa over. Remove the broken leg by unscrewing it. If the hanger bolt is still in the sofa, you'll need to remove it. Use a kitchen knife to dislodge it. Legs come with new hanger bolts; the old one may not fit the new leg. Remove a leg that's not broken and take it with you to a home improvement or hardware store.

    • 2

      Ask to see the plastic legs. Compare the plastic leg with the leg removed from the sofa to get a proper fit. The style can be different but the width at the top of the leg should be the same to ensure stability of the couch. If you're unsure, ask the trained assistant in that department. .

    • 3

      Unscrew and remove the remaining legs. Remove the new legs from the package and screw them into the sofa, being careful to screw them in evenly and tightly.

    • 4

      Return the sofa to the upright position. Try moving the sofa back and forth to check for stability. Sit down cautiously the first time to see if the legs will hold the weight of someone sitting on the sofa.
